What is Micro Soccer

Mercer Island FC MicroSoccer is designed for our youngest soccer players. This program is the perfect opportunity to come out and start building on the basics of soccer while playing with friends and having fun!

Micro Soccer is led by our Head of Micro Soccer, Elliot Fauske, along with paid trainers. The main Micro program runs for 8 weeks in the fall, as well as a 6 week spring program.
The spring program consists of TRAINING ONLY, to serve as a refresher or introduction for players.



SPRING MICROSOCCER


The spring Micro Soccer program serves as the connection point between seasons, to refresh the players after their break from the fall season, and introduce new players into the training methods of the Micro Soccer program. A training-only program, this provides players the opportunity to enter the sport in a low-competition environment, based entirely around enjoyment and discovery of soccer.



FALL MICROSOCCER


Fall Micro Soccer offers an optional training on Wednesdays led by our paid trainers as well as a team game on Saturdays led by volunteer parent coaches (this could be you!). The format for Saturdays begins with an MIFC game day curriculum delivered by parent volunteer coaches in a 15 minute training session. This is a great opportunity to participate in your child's discovery of their love for the game! We finish the Saturday session by playing a game against another Micro Soccer team which allows the kids to put their new learning on display for all their adoring fans :)

Training & Game Day Philosophy

Philosophy   The Micro Soccer philosophy is built on the principle of teaching players to be familiar and comfortable with the ball at their feet, and aiding them in being excited participants in trainings and games. We encourage technical discovery through enjoyment and social connections to ensure a deep-rooted connection to the game and their community.


The learning which takes place in Micro Soccer will provide the foundation for players to progress into future MIFC programs, the first steps being into Rec or our more competitive-driven Juniors program.


Game Day (FALL ONLY)   Games are played in 2v2 formats. This is built off the Belgian model of player development, placing the main focus on enjoyment and to allow players huge involvement and touches, and avoid the messy "beehive" which can form with greater numbers of players. Prioritizing 2-player relationships so players can discover their individual understanding of the game along with how to work collaboratively with a partner, players will be encouraged and free to be active participants in games in a setting which allows them total exploration.


Training   Training sessions which are led by our Head of Micro and paid coaches take snapshots of the development pillars, and provide a fun and exciting opportunity for young players to explore and learn more skills. Players will find a fun and supportive environment focused on teaching them foundational skills and helping them to discover their relationship to the game.

Uniforms & Gear

As part of the fall registration, MicroSoccer players receive a team jersey. Spring players will receive a training top.


Parents are responsible for ensuring their players wear/bring the following to every session:

  • Size #3 soccer ball with their name on it
  • Water bottle
  • Shoes - cleats are not required, but are recommended as the sessions are on grass. Cleats will give better traction, especially on wet grass. Tennis or athletic shoes are acceptable
